‘The Walking Dead: Dead City’ Season 2 Release Schedule: When Are New Episodes Out?
Image
Negan (Jeffrey Dean Morgan) and Maggie (Lauren Cohan) don’t have it easy in zombie-filled New York City.

One of AMC’s major spinoffs from its flagship undead series, “The Walking Dead: Dead City” finally returns and finds the unlikely allies continuing to fight in a war for control of NYC. The second season of the show looks to be bloodier and more brutal than ever.

Here’s everything you need to know about where and when to tune in for the second season of AMC’s “The Walking Dead: Dead City.”

When does “The Walking Dead: Dead City” Season 2 come out?

“The Walking Dead: Dead City” Season 2 begins on Sunday, May 4.

How can I watch “The Walking Dead: Dead City” Season 2?

The second season of “The Walking Dead: Dead City” will air on AMC on Sunday nights and will be available to stream on AMC+.

The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2 Trailer Finds Negan Taking Control Of A Lawless New York As He & Maggie Reunite
Image
A new trailer for The Walking Dead: Dead City season 2 has been released, teasing Negan taking over a Lawless New York as he and Maggie reunite. Dead City season 1 ended with Negan (Jeffrey Dean Morgan) agreeing to help the Dama (Lisa Emery) unite Manhattan under her rule. In the meantime, Maggie (Lauren Cohan) has decided to return to New York to save Negan, feeling guilty for trading him to get Hershel (Logan Kim) back. The pair are expected to go back together in search of the former antagonist to get him back to the mainland.

Now, The Walking Deadhas released a trailer for Dead City season 2, teasing Negan stepping into a leadership role for the Burazi. The trailer begins with Maggie returning to Manhattan, crossing Perlie Armstrong (Gaius Charles) and seemingly asking him why he wants to bring back the city. First Look at Sons of Anarchy Star's New Villain in Walking Dead Spinoff Revealed
Image
New images and a teaser trailer have been revealed for the second season of The Walking Dead: Dead City. They showcase a first look at Sons of Anarchy star Kim Coates making his debut in the Walking Dead franchise.

In The Walking Dead: Dead City Season 2, Coates will be featured as a major villain. In a first look photo of his character, Coates can be seen suited up with multiple rings on his fingers while holding a cane. A new teaser trailer also reveals the first footage of Coates in character, as he is briefly shown emerging from a building with an army behind him. The character appears to be reacting to Negan (Jeffrey Dean Morgan) bringing power back to Manhattan, which may lead to an unintended conflict. ‘Dear Edward’ Canceled by Apple TV+ After One Season
Dear Edward (2023)
“Dear Edward” won’t be getting a second season on Apple TV+. The streamer has canceled the drama after one season, TheWrap has confirmed.

The series was a reunion for of “Friday Night Lights” showrunner Katims and star Connie Britton. The drama was based on Ann Napolitano’s 2020 novel of the same name, as it followed a preteen named Edward – played by Colin O’Brien of “Grey’s Anatomy” who was the only survivor of a plane crash that killed his family. Unexpected friendships, romances and communities are formed, as Edward and others figure out how to move forward in the wake of the crash.
